The image describes the olive oil production process: (1) Collecting olives using a rake, (2) Storing olives in a vat for 2 to 3 days, (3) Washing olives with cool water, (4) Crushing olives with a hammer, producing olive paste, which is then moved to a container while olive stones are separated out, (5) Pressing and filtering the olive paste using a hydraulic press with filters to extract oil, (6) Spinning and separating in a centrifuge to obtain oil and water, (7) Bottling oil, and (8) Transporting bottled oil to the store.
